I'm ready to reinstall the entire rudder assembly on my '59 CC Continental 18'. I'm aware of the sealing in the packing nut on the rudder itself. What material do you recommend I use to seal around the two carriage bolts that hold the rudder shaft log?

I used a small amount of 3M5200. Applied a small bead around the rudder tube-to-hull as well. Yes, 5200 can be a challenge to remove a fitting later, but applying heat to the fitting or bolt should loosen it up if you didn't go crazy with the 5200. If you sealed the wood at the bolts and tube areas well with CPES, any possible seepage should not get into the wood.

A less permanent sealant like maybe Boatlife caulk might be better for future removal.

We use BoatLife to bed running gear in our shop.
